Transaction ef093159d1b97e3315a51a5d65443a79c45220849159c37b35482172d9b6e401
1 Input
1 Output
-
ef093159d1b97e3315a51a5d65443a79c45220849159c37b35482172d9b6e401:0
- value
- 598668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0056002c774300e650c73e287aa43808d288ac7 OP_EQUAL
- address
- 3N7Xiyh8CqHGhduDQ788Eso1UkyfXwjm48